Understanding what is personalized cancer medicine: Tailored Treatments for Enhanced Outcomes
What is personalized cancer medicine concerns tailoring treatment plans exactly to the genetic makeup of each patient.
Utilizing a patient's genetic profile, doctors can forecast which treatments are most likely to be effective, minimizing the risk of side effects and enhancing the probability of successful outcomes.
This approach is revolutionizing the field of oncology, yielding treatments that are as distinct as the patients themselves.
Tailored medicine not only boosts treatment efficacy but also elevates patient quality of life by eliminating unnecessary or ineffective treatments.
